The functions of LED CoSim+:
• Possibility to run the cost simulation for a variety of different conditions (region, clean room class, process type, etc)
• Integrated Equipment, Wafer & Materials Databases
• Very high flexibility:
• LED CoSim+ allows the user to enter any LED process flow
• The manufacturing process flows are created dynamically in a friendly hierarchical view where each process step can be moved, modified or deleted.
• The user can save an unlimited number of process flows, equipment types and materials
• A project manager function offers the possibility to save all the user created data and scenario (wafer Fab unit, process flow, yields…) and to reuse them later
• Two calculation modes: for dedicated fabs and non-dedicated fabs.
• Simulation of up to five simultaneous scenarios allowing the user to run sensitivity analysis and compare results like yield improvement, manufacturing location impact on cost, etc.
• LED CoSim+ uses an ExcelTM interface for maximum usability. This tool will enable you to evaluate the cost per wafer for manufacturing using your own inputs or using the pre-defined parameters included with the tool.
Compare up to 5 different scenarios
• Cost of the wafer with breakdown (depreciation cost, manufacturing cost, labor cost, yield losses)
• Cost of the wafer by step (implantation, etching, metallization, back-face grinding…)
• Equipment cost of the wafer by step
• Equipment cost of the wafer by equipment family (etching, deposition, lithography, implant…)
• Material cost of the wafer by step (wet chemicals, gases, sputter targets…)
• Material cost of the wafer by material family
• Cost of the die with breakdown between wafer, test, dicing...
• Cost of the component with breakdown for die cost, packaging cost, final test cost, yield losses
• Estimation of the manufacturing price of the component according to published manufacturer financial results
